在CSS中处理换行符换行的问题,可以通过多种方式来实现。以下是一些常见的方法及其详细说明: 1. 使用 white-space 属性 white-space 属性用于控制空白字符(包括空格、制表符、换行符等)的处理方式。通过设置 white-space 的不同值,可以控制文本是否换行以及如何换行。 pre-wrap:保留空白符,但文本会根据需要自动换行。
break-word (允许在长单词或URL内部换行) white-space: normal (空白会被浏览器忽略) pre (空白会被浏览器保留) nowrap (文本不会换行,直到遇见) pre-wrap (保留空白符序列,但会正常的换行) pre-line (合并空白符序列,但会保留换行符) word-break: normal(浏览器默认的换行规则) break-all (允许在单词内...
由于在 Web 中,换行符都会按照空格进行解析,因此,当一段文字设置为 white-space:nowrap,中文也会在一行显示,因为让中文换行的这个换行符解析成了 white-space。 七、英文标点强制换行 某些英文表单具有不可换行特性,例如 i'm 这个单词,其中的单引号具有特殊含义,默认是不能换行的。 此时,我们可以设置如下所示的 ...
当文本所在容器的宽度固定时,可以使用 overflow-wrap: break-word; 和 overflow-wrap: anywhere; 来实现文本的自动换行;如果容器宽度为 min-content,就只能使用 overflow-wrap: break-word; 实现文本换行;overflow-wrap: break-word;也可以用于长标点符号的换行。 今天来研究一下 CSS 中的文本换行。正常情况下,在...
nowrap: 文本不会换行,文本会在在同一行上继续,直到遇到 br 标签为止。 pre-wrap: 保留空白符序列,但是正常地进行换行。 pre-line: 合并空白符序列,但是保留换行符。 inherit: 规定应该从父元素继承 white-space 属性的值。 word-wrap:normal|break-word; ...
[1]firefox及safari: 中文到边界上的汉字换行,且允许标点置于段首 [2]IE及chrome: 中文到边界上的汉字换行,但不允许标点置于段首 keep-all: 对于英文长文本不能换行,但对于中文的处理,各浏览器不一致 [1]firefox: 在空白符处换行 [2]IE及chrome: 在空白符及标点处换行 ...
在CSS中定义换行符可以使用`white-space`属性。`white-space`属性用于指定元素内空白的处理方式,其中包括换行符。 常用的`white-space`属性取值有: 1. `no...
normal:连续的空白符会被合并,换行符会被当作空白符处理。填充line盒子时,必要的话会换行。 nowrap:和normal一样,连续的空白符会被合并。但文本内的换行无效。 pre:连续的空白符会被保留。在遇到换行符或者元素时才会换行。 pre-wrap:连续的空白符会被保留。在遇到换行符或者元素,或者需要为了填充line盒子时才会换...
在CSS中,可以使用display属性来控制两个div容器的布局方式。具体来说,可以使用display: inline;或display: inline-block;来实现两个div容器的交替换行符。 display: inline; 使用display: inline;可以将两个div容器设置为行内元素,使它们在同一行显示,并在内容过长时自动换行。这种布局适用于需要在一行内显示多个容器...